Porto Judeu (Pass by)

Port Judeu, on the south coast of Terceira, stands out as a parish marked by its historic heritage, the impressive Atlantic landscape and a community that preserves centuries-old traditions while embracing the serenity of the sea that shapes it.

Salga Bay

  • 10m
The Battle of Salga, which took place in 1581 in Port Judeu, is remembered as a decisive episode of the Azorian resistance, when a group of inhabitants of Terceira managed to repel Castilian troops using ingenuity, courage and even wild cattle to defend the island during the crisis of Portuguese succession.

Farol Das Contendas (Pass by)

The Contendas Lighthouse, in the Ponta das Contendas of Terceira Island, stands out as a coastal landmark since 1934, built on a wild and protected landscape, guiding the navigation while contemplating one of the most beautiful and preserved areas of the Terceira coast.

Igreja Matriz de Sao Sebastiao

  • 20m
The Parish Church of St. Sebastian, located in the Villa of St. Sebastian on the island of Terceira, stands out as one of the oldest churches in the Azores, founded in the 15th century and recognised by the rare frescoes of the 16th century, for its simple yet imposing architecture, and for the profound historical and religious value it has preserved since the early days of the Azorian settlement.

Porto Martins Natural Pools

  • 10m
Porto Martins, on the south coast of Terceira, is a parish known for its natural pools, its peaceful atmosphere by the sea and its mild climate which makes it one of the most pleasant places on the island to swim, walk and live by the sea.

Praia da Vitória

  • 20m
Praia da Vitória, on the eastern coast of the island of Terceira, stands out as one of the largest and most welcoming cities in the Azores, known for its wide bay, vibrant marina and a relaxed atmosphere that uniquely combines history, the sea and urban life.

Furnas do Enxofre

  • 30m
The Sulphur Furnas, located in the centre of Terceira Island, is a fumarolic field where volcanic gases are released through cracks in the soil. This geothermal phenomenon creates a unique environment, with intense vapors and sulphur odour, revealing the volcanic activity still present on the island and offering visitors a striking experience of direct contact with the force of nature.

Biscoitos

  • 30m
The Biscoitos, on the north coast of Terceira, are famous for their natural pools of volcanic origin, the vineyards grown in black stone walls and for a landscape marked by the contrast between basalt, the sea and the wine tradition that defines the identity of the parish.
